Knoxville, TN (WOKI) The City of Knoxville Wednesday extends the deadline for Knoxville College to repair or close off the McKee Administration Building, which the city says is in serious disrepair. Knoxville College, East Tennessee’s only historically Black college or university, has been working to regain accreditation and repair much of its main campus since…MORE

Boyd Sports has partnered with the City of Knoxville and Knox County to develop a comprehensive parking plan for Knoxville Smokies games and other event days at Covenant Health Park, downtown Knoxville’s new publicly owned sports and entertainment stadium. The collaborative parking plan features more than 1,500 dedicated parking spaces to serve Covenant Health Park,…MORE

Harrogate, TN (WOKI) We’re learning more now about Monday’s deadly restaurant fire in Claiborne County. The fire at Bronco Mexican Restaurant in Harrogate prompted a response from several agencies. Officials with the Claiborne County Sheriff’s Office say that after getting the fire under control, firefighters found a body inside; that person died of smoke inhalation.…MORE
